cute story from the Bay Area
Ten times in the last six month, Revolution Books, the far left bookstore in the Telegraph Channing Mall, has found itself under attack from far-right activists.
The latest skirmish was Sat. March 4, the one-year anniversary of the pro-Trump rally in Martin Luther King Jr. Park that saw people on the right and Antifa and BAMN activists duking it out for control. A group of people who called themselves “Berkeley Warriors” on a live Facebook feed came from Sacramento and stormed the store.
“Fucking Commie scum,” one demonstrator, Rob Cantrall, said on a video taken by bookstore staff while Reiko Redmonde, a volunteer manager at the store, tried to prevent him and others from entering. “You are commie scum. We are going to burn down your bookstore. You know that, right?”

The quotes they excerpt are more feel good facebook meme than alt right screed.
I think combining these different sides is part of the reason for his popularity. He has credibility for many young men as a source of life advice because they see him as being on the right side of the culture war against feminists and trans people.
Meanwhile, some who are leery of the alt-right see at least something compelling in what he says about psychology, mythology, archetypes, etc., and so they go to bat for him in trying to disentangle it all.

That’s where I live and work; I was out of town last week but followed along on Twitter. Some small number of nazis met up with 500+ protestors, only about 10 people made it into his talk and like half of those were journalists. And all this happened on the first day of spring break in a cow barn in the middle of nowhere. His meeting / conference scheduled for the previous day in the Detroit burbs never happened as the venues cancelled when they figured out who had made the reservations, antifa folks were tailing them around and hassling them while they were awaiting directions and one Nazi got arrested for pulling a gun on someone.
